Mondelez International is an American multinational confectionery, food, and beverage company founded in 2012 as a spin-off from Kraft Foods. Mondelez owns some of the world's most beloved snack brands including Cadbury (chocolate), Oreo (cookies), Toblerone, Milka, Tang, Ritz, and Sour Patch Kids. The company has a massive presence in India where Cadbury is the undisputed chocolate leader. Mondelez employs over 91,000 people and reported $36.0 billion in revenue in 2023.
